There's an Uber/Lyft/Taxi drop off / pick up location on Harbor, across the street from Coldstone. Super easy!

Uber also has the real time gps location of the car, car type and driver's name, but when there are lots of people getting picked up in the same location, it has gotten confusing for us a couple of times. My hubby usually handles booking it so I don't know if Uber provides a picture of the driver...The Lyft app provides you with a photo of your driver and a description of the vehicle, plus a real-time map of the driver's location, so I've never had a problem finding my Lyft car in a crowd.
Thanks, that's good to know!The Uber App also provides the license plate number of the car and a photo of the driver.
